History and physical examination are sufficient to relate the pain to one or more of the lateral femoral cutaneous (LFC), ilioinguinal (II), iliohypogastric (IH), or genitofemoral (GF) nerves. Abdominal surgery has been known on occasion to cause damage to the ilioinguinal, iliohypogastric, or genitofemoral nerves—each of which can cause postoperative pelvic nerve pain..
